Sea Grape and Persian Violet Physical Information

Sea Grape and Persian Violet physical information is very important for comparison. Sea Grape height is 610.00 cm and width 610.00 cm whereas Persian Violet height is 25.40 cm and width 25.40 cm. The color specification of Sea Grape and Persian Violet are as follows:

  • Sea Grape flower color: White

  • Sea Grape leaf color: Red, Olive and Bronze

  • Persian Violet flower color: Purple and Violet

  • Persian Violet leaf color: Dark Green

Care of Sea Grape and Persian Violet

Care of Sea Grape and Persian Violet include pruning, fertilizers, watering etc. Sea Grape pruning is done Remove dead branches and Persian Violet pruning is done Pinch Tips, Prune prior to new growth and Prune to stimulate growth. In summer Sea Grape needs Lots of watering and in winter, it needs Average Water. Whereas, in summer Persian Violet needs Lots of watering and in winter, it needs Average Water.
